Agricultural employee definition

Agricultural employee means a person working for an agricultural undertaking or an agricultural employer for any period of time and who receives remuneration;
Agricultural employee means any individual employed to perform agricultural work, including any individual whose work has ceased as a consequence of, or in connection with, any current labor dispute or because of any prohibited labor practice, who has not obtained any other substantially equivalent employment. Agricultural employee means a person who habitually engages in agricultural employment on the land of another, where that employment is based on a contract to employ that person;
Agricultural employee means a person engaged in agriculture, including: farming in all its branches, and, among other things, includes the cultivation and tillage of the soil, dairying, the production, cultivation, growing, and harvesting of any agricultural or horticultural commodities, the raising of livestock, bees, furbearing animals, or poultry, and any practices performed by a farmer or on a farm as an incident to or in conjunction with such farming operations, including preparation for market and delivery to storage or to market or to carriers for transportation to market.

Agricultural employee means a person employed by an agricultural employer.
Agricultural employee means each full-time and each part-time non-seasonal employee within this state reported by the owner or operator of an agricultural facility to the Department of Revenue Labor and Employment Security for unemployment compensation tax purposes, the total number of which shall not be less than the number for the month reflecting the lowest number of employees for the calendar year.
Agricultural employee means an employee engaged in agriculture, which includes farming in all its branches, including but not limited to the cultivation and tillage of the soil, dairying, the production, cultivation, growing, and harvesting of any agricultural or horticultural commodities, the raising of livestock, bees, furbearing animals, or poultry, and any practices performed by a farmer or on a farm as an incident to or in conjunction with such farming operations, including preparation for market and delivery to storage or to market or to carriers for transportation to market, as further defined in CA Labor Code §1140.4(b). “Agricultural Employee” also means farm worker, farmworker, or farm laborer. “Agricultural Employee” does not include persons engaged in household domestic service, or certain employees of religious or charitable entities listed in §17005(b) and (c) of the Act.
